使cassandra在本地节点上存储数据

时间:2010-08-26 16:15:15

标签: cassandra

配置cassandra集群的简单方法是什么,如果我尝试在其中存储密钥,它将存储在我发出set / write命令的本地节点中?

我正在查看IPartitioner,它允许我指定如何对键进行哈希处理,但对于类似上面的内容,它似乎有点重。

谢谢!

1 个答案:

答案 0 :(得分:4)

如果您能够随意地将密钥写入任意节点,那么在查找时,系统将不知道该密钥的数据存在于何处。系统必须进行完整的群集查找,这将非常慢。

按照设计,Cassandra以已知的方式传播数据,以便快速查找。

查看Cassandra主要维护者Jonathan Ellis的this post